Yuvraj lay on his bed, staring at the ceiling, a smile tugging at his lips. The events of the previous night were fresh in his mind, a kaleidoscope of colors and emotions. He couldn't believe how everything had changed between him and Aisha. For so long, they had been at each other's throats, the very definition of enemies. But now, after the cultural fest, everything was different.

the morning after the cultural fest:

Yuvraj woke up with a contented sigh, the memories of last night warming his heart. He reached for his phone, eager to send Aisha a message, but before he could type anything, his phone rang. It was his younger brother, Aman.

"Bhaiya, urgent hai," Aman said, his voice strained.

"Abhi subah subah kya urgent ho gaya?" Yuvraj asked, sitting up.

"Aap jaldi ghar aao. Papa ki tabiyat theek nahi lag rahi."

Yuvraj's heart sank. His father had been battling health issues for a while, but this sounded serious. "Main abhi aata hoon."

He quickly got dressed and rushed out of his penthouse, his mind racing with worry. He tried to call Aisha to explain, but her number went straight to voicemail. Shit. She's going to be worried, he thought, but there was no time. He had to get home.

at Rathore Mansion:

The house was in chaos when he arrived. His mother was pacing, her face pale with worry, while Aman was on the phone with the doctor.

"Kya hua?" Yuvraj asked, his voice trembling.

"Mujhe nahi pata," his mother said, tears streaming down her face. "Unhone subah se kuch nahi bola. Just collapsed."

Yuvraj's heart clenched. He rushed to his father's side, taking his hand. "Papa, main hoon yahan. Aap theek ho jayenge."

The doctor arrived soon after, and Yuvraj stepped back, giving him space to work. He watched, helpless, as the doctor examined his father, his mind a blur of fear and anxiety.

After what felt like an eternity, the doctor turned to him. "He needs to be hospitalized. Immediately."

Yuvraj nodded, his throat tight. He helped carry his father to the car, his mind racing. I need to tell Aisha. She'll understand. But there was no time to call her. He could only hope she would forgive him for disappearing without a word.

at the hospital:

The next few hours were a blur of doctors, nurses, and medical jargon that Yuvraj could barely process. His father was taken into surgery, and Yuvraj sat in the waiting room, his head in his hands. Aman sat next to him, silent but supportive.
